LIPOR receives international visits in may to share good practices in waste management and sustainability
LIPOR is about to receive three important international delegations in May, reinforcing its role as a benchmark in sustainable waste management and the circular economy.
The first visit, scheduled for the beginning of the month, is part of the XIX International Benchmarking Sanitation and Waste Europe, which will bring a group of businesspeople and political decision-makers from Brazil to Portugal. The aim is to learn about the best practices adopted by LIPOR, from waste recovery to environmental education initiatives, which have put the Greater Porto region at the forefront of sustainability.
The Environment Committee of the Parliament of the State of Lower Saxony, Germany, will be present on 9 May. The German delegation, interested in public environmental policies and technological solutions for waste management, will have the opportunity to visit LIPOR's facilities and discuss models of co-operation between the public and private sectors.
Finally, on the 16th, it will be the turn of a group of students from the University of South Carolina Business School, who will be visiting Porto as part of an academic programme focused on sustainability and business innovation. LIPOR will serve as a case study, showing how a public organisation can lead the transition to a greener economy.
These visits highlight the international recognition of the work carried out by LIPOR, which continues to position Portugal as an example to follow in the management of waste management.
